R47 BOE is a 1998 Aprilia RS125 in Black with a 125c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 1998 Aprilia RS125 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.2% with a typical mileage of 19,900 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Aprilia RS125 fails its MOT is br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ick, accounting for 1,940 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R47 BOE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Aprilia RS125 typ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 28 years old, this Aprilia RS125 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
